I'm 5'11", 16" 1.50" gangster, 1.5 risers. They fit me just above the shoulder. I was going to get the 14"/1.25 but the indy talk me out of it, he said you will wish you got the 16" if you got the 14". Very happy I listen to him.

Im 5'8" and I got 16" Carlini Gangsters with stock risers and Im sitting on a LePera Barebones solo seat. It fits me just fine. Not too high and not too low.
